STAMP OFFICE,

HONGKONG, 1st November, 1877.

SIR,

I have the honour to enclose the usual monthly Returns relative to

5 of 1868 (Stamp Duties). Revenue collected under the Ordinances indicated in the margin during the past

month; the total collected in that period being $9,914.63.

1 of 1873 (Sheriff's).

5 of 1874 (Emigration).

I also append a comparison between the amount collected this year up to the 31st ultimo and that collected during the corresponding months of 1876.

1877. Up to October 31st,

$98,161.51

1876.

$87,033.66

Increase,

$11,127.85
